Why You Need a Semi Truck Accident Attorney

Truck accidents can cause serious injuries that can alter the victim's lifestyle. Victims can be hit with huge medical bills, and could be laid off from work while they recover.

A semi truck accident attorney can help victims recover compensation from the negligent party accountable for the accident. The most popular kinds of damages are noneconomic and economic damages.

Insurance Negotiations

It's possible for victims of semi truck accidents to negotiate their own settlements. However, doing this without an attorney is a major disadvantage. The stakes involved in NYC truck accidents are much higher than those involving regular automobiles because the damage to property and injuries are more severe. Insurance policies for trucks could be more expensive than the policies for personal vehicles. Insurance companies are therefore more likely to deny to compensate.

An attorney will manage the negotiations and ensure that the insurance providers of the party at fault treat you fairly, respecting your rights. They'll also make sure that the total value of your losses is reflected in the settlement offer. You could be refunded for medical expenses, lost income, and any other costs incurred due to your injury. It may also include compensation for emotional suffering, permanent impairment, and loss of enjoyment of life.

Finding out the extent of your losses can be difficult, especially if still recovering from injuries. An attorney can help determine what your losses are actually worth, taking into account the current and future costs of your medical care and the impact on quality of life, and other aspects. The lawyer will then send a demand note stating the amount to the insurance provider.

The first offer from the insurance company will probably be lower than what you requested in your letter of demand. This is due to them trying to save money each year by cutting down on their claims. In addition, the insurance representatives will probably attempt to make you say things that could be used against you in the future. They may even ask you to sign an authorization form for medical treatment for instance.

Your lawyer will remain firm and will not give into these tactics. They will let the insurer know you are not intimidated by attempts to reduce or deny your claim. the amount. They will also ensure that all conversations are recorded in writing. In this way, if any of your statements are taken out of context or misinterpreted, you'll have proof that you were not responsible for the incident.

Trials

With their massive size and imposing presence on New York's roads, large trucks pose serious dangers to drivers and passengers. These accidents often lead to devastating injuries that may permanently change victims' lives. These accidents can also create financial stress to victims and their families. The injuries that result from truck accidents are often very costly to treat and victims could experience significant loss of income as a result of the absence of work. Additionally, medical bills and funeral costs can quickly mount up. A Queens truck accident attorney will assist victims to receive the compensation they're entitled to.

A successful case involving a truck accident will require a thorough investigation in order to determine the cause of a crash and determine who is at fault. A skilled semi truck accident attorney can assist clients in identifying all potential defendants, including the truck driver the employer of the driver, as well as third party entities like freight brokers or manufacturers. The lawyer can also look into the truck's "black box" to obtain information about the incident, such as speed as well as tire pressure and whether brakes were used.

To prove negligence, the lawyer has to prove that the truck driver was not acting with reasonable care. This could include driving recklessly or not checking blindspots before changing lanes. If the trucker's employer hired a driver without proper licensing or training to operate a vehicle of this danger it could be held liable for a lack of training and hiring or supervision. The trucking industry must also maintain their vehicles to ensure that they are safe to operate.

Lawyers for victims of injuries can seek compensation for both economic and other losses. These damages could be in the form of future medical expenses, funeral expenses, lost income and loss of consortium and many more. Attorneys may also apply for punitive damages if the actions of the defendant were found to have been particularly injurious or malicious.

The earlier a victim can hire a Queens truck accident lawyer, the better. Lawyers can ensure that the case is filed within the applicable statute of limitations to decrease the risk that it will be dismissed. Additionally, the lawyer can help victims understand their rights and responsibilities.

Expert Witnesses

The injuries caused by accidents involving semi trucks can be severe. In addition to the extensive medical treatment, victims could lose their earnings or quality of life as a consequence. These losses could constitute a substantial portion of the claim for compensation. Expert witnesses may be required to support your claim for damages. Your semi truck accident lawyer can offer this service. Expert witnesses are those who have specific knowledge and skills that enable them to assess information related to the incident and offer their professional opinions to jurors.

The type of experts used in cases can differ based on the needs of each case. A medical expert, like an orthopedist or neurologist, can provide evidence of the severity of your injuries, and how they impact your future. A vocation expert will examine your employment history, education level and training to determine whether permanent injuries can hinder your ability to perform certain jobs.

Experts in accident reconstruction can look over evidence, like black box data and damage to vehicles to determine the cause of the crash. Other experts can give details on the road conditions and trucking safety regulations. Other types of experts who are helpful in personal injury cases include forensic engineers, mechanical engineers and chemical engineers.

Despite the importance of expert witness testimony, some truck accidents do not get to trial. Most claims involving truck accidents are resolved through negotiations with insurance companies. However, if a trial is necessary, the experts who are qualified can make all the difference.

A skilled semi truck accident lawyer can anticipate the expert witnesses the trucking firm will employ and respond accordingly. Your attorney will be able present a stronger case for you and ensure that you receive the most money possible through experts on your side. For instance, the trucking company may employ an expert to question your injuries and suggest that you're exaggerating your losses or have a preexisting condition that limits your ability to work. Your attorney will call an expert similar to the claims made by the trucking company's personal expert witness.

Compensation

A seasoned semi truck accident law firms truck accident lawyer will help you build a strong case. This includes determining who should be sued and how much compensation you can claim, and the best way of presenting that information. Your lawyer will ensure that your claim is filed prior to the expiration date of your statute of limitation. Lawsuits are often dismissed out of court when they're not filed by the deadline.

When calculating your damages your lawyer will also consider medical costs and lost wages you were able to lose due to the truck accident. They will also seek compensation for the suffering and pain, which includes the loss of enjoyment from life. They may consult with a group or professionals such as economists life care planners, and accountants to assess the losses.

Your lawyer will negotiate with the insurance company on your behalf. This is a challenging task since the primary goal of the insurance company is to limit your losses. Negotiating with insurance companies requires years of experience and training. Your attorney will only be compensated if they win your case.

Lack of maintenance is an often-cited cause of truck crashes. If a trucking company does not maintain their truck in a timely manner, it could lead to brake failure or any other technical error which causes a collision with your vehicle. The lawyer will investigate the accident to determine if the truck was not properly maintained and if someone was responsible for maintenance.

A truck accident could also occur if the driver did not follow federal regulations. For instance, if a truck driver was driving while tired, it would be in violation of the rules. Be aware that truck drivers are required to have a set amount of time off after a certain number of hours.

Your lawyer will gather and review all documents related to the accident. In a demand letter the lawyer will send the information to the insurance company of the party at responsible. Depending on your case's facts the lawyer could issue multiple demand letters. They will then discuss with the insurance company until they reach a settlement that is fair to your particular circumstance.
